What to track for IT & facilities

• Devices and tools with identity details • Assignments and custody trail • Transfers between offices and sites • Status and lifecycle notes • Exportable inventories for audits and planning

Typical workflow

01

Register assets

Create consistent asset records with identity and home locations.

02

Assign and transfer

Record assignments and transfers so accountability is clear across teams.

03

Track lifecycle changes

Log repairs, spares, and retirement decisions with context.

04

Export for audits

Export clean inventories and history for audits and refresh planning.

FAQ

Can we track tools and devices together?

Yes—track any asset type and keep location/custody history consistent.

Does this help with audits?

Yes—export-ready inventories and history reduce audit time significantly.

Can we model multiple offices?

Yes—use site and sub-location structure for consistent reporting.

Can we track repairs and spares?

Yes—statuses and locations capture repair and spare workflows.

Where should we start?

Start with laptops and shared equipment, then expand to tools and facilities assets.
